How do I pay, and when?
A deposit at order to cover materials, a stage payment when the work leaves the workshop, and the balance on completion after you have inspected the fit. Everything is written into the quotation before you commit.
Do you charge for the survey and drawings?
The measured survey and the quotation are free. If you want fully detailed manufacturing drawings or a 3D visual before committing, that is chargeable and the fee comes off the job if you proceed.
Can you match existing joinery in the house?
Yes. We take a profile of the existing skirting, architrave or door and either match it from stock cutters or have a cutter ground so the new work runs identically. Matching an old paint colour is straightforward; matching aged oak takes a sample panel and a couple of attempts, which we build into the programme.
What guarantee do you give?
Ten years on workmanship. Hardware carries the manufacturer's warranty, which on good runners and hinges is usually lifetime. Finishes are guaranteed for five years against flaking or delamination in normal domestic use.
